The intent of running on every CPU is to verify MSR_IA32_FEATURE_CONTROL is correctly configured on all CPUs. It's extremely unlikely that firmware would misconfigure or fail to write the MSR on only APs, but if that does happen we'll spam dmesg and possibly panic or hang the kernel. The severity of the fallout is why we're being paranoid. KVM is similarly paranoid about VMX enabling since it'll BUG() on an unexpected fault due to a misconfigured FEATURE_CONTROL.
